Output 7aff89e7744963af7d9e4e5a478626e5b1012c5ee55f4a9d141fa0d53f24cc63:42

value
619682
script pubkey
OP_0 OP_PUSHBYTES_20 56b0abb0f04f76dbaa860c65124d7ed098058959
address
bc1q26c2hv8sfamdh25xp3j3ynt76zvqtz2e85wmfn
transaction
7aff89e7744963af7d9e4e5a478626e5b1012c5ee55f4a9d141fa0d53f24cc63
spent
true